Wanda Austin, PhD
CEO & Founder — MakingSpace, Inc.
A leadership development consultant and motivational speaker, Wanda Austin is the retired CEO of The Aerospace Corporation. She served as interim president of the University of Southern California 2018 -2019 and authored Making Space: Strategic Leadership for a Complex World. Her board service governance work has included chairing audit, compensation and public policy committees as an independent director. She earned a B.A. in mathematics from Franklin & Marshall College, M.S. degrees in systems engineering and mathematics from the University of Pittsburgh, and a Ph.D. in industrial and systems engineering from USC. She is a member of the National Academy of Engineering and a member of NACD.
Corporate Boards: Chevron, Amgen
Gail Lione
Senior Counsel — Dentons
Gail Lione is Senior Counsel at Dentons US LLP and an adjunct professor of intellectual property law at Georgetown University Law School. Ms. Lione is also a Senior Fellow of the ESG Center of The Conference Board and she currently serves as a director of two companies. She has been a member of the Board of Directors of Sargento Foods Inc. since 2006, and the Board of Directors of Badger Meter, Inc. (NYSE:BMI) since 2012. Ms. Lione formerly served as a director of Imperial Sugar Company (NASDAQ:IPSU) and a director of The F. Dohmen Co, a Wisconsin private company in the life science services business. She is a member of Women Corporate Directors, Washington DC chapter. For most of her career, Ms. Lione was a corporate officer in the C-Suite serving as General Counsel of 3 companies in 3 different industries. In her last executive assignment, she was the Executive Vice President, General Counsel, Secretary and Chief Compliance Officer of Harley-Davidson, Inc. and President of The Harley-Davidson Foundation. She also served as Vice President of Human Resources for 2 years. In October 2017, Ms. Lione was honored by DirectWomen with the Sandra Day O’Connor Board Excellence Award for serving with distinction as an independent director of public companies and for working to advance the value of diversity in board positions. Directors & Boards magazine featured Ms. Lione as a Director to Watch in its 2015 Annual Report and she was listed as a 2019 Most Influential Corporate Board Director by WomenInc. Magazine. Also in 2019 she was featured in Winning the Board Game: How Women Corporate DIrectors Make the Difference , written by Betsy Berkhemer-Credaire.
Corporate Boards: Sargento Foods, Badger Meter Inc
Angelique Brunner
Founder & CEO — EB5 Capital
Angel Brunner is the CEO and Founder of EB5 Capital. Founded in 2008, EB5 Capital is a $750 million commercial real estate investment firm with more than 25 projects across all commercial real estate asset classes. The company has served 1,600 clients, from 65 countries, creating more than 35,000 U.S. jobs to-date. Over the course of her 25-year career, Ms. Brunner has worked in various aspects of capital markets, real estate, and early-stage funding. In Q3 of 2020, she was appointed to and currently serves on the board of Cushman & Wakefield, (NYSE: CWK). Ms. Brunner holds a BA in Public Policy from Brown University and an MPA from Princeton University.
Corporate Boards: Cushman & Wakefield
Rodrigo Garcia
Deputy Treasurer and Chief Investment Officer — Illinois State Treasurer
Rodrigo Garcia, CTP®, AIF® is the deputy state treasurer and chief investment officer for Illinois State Treasurer Michael W. Frerichs. He directs the treasury’s combined $35 billion investment portfolio, $300 billion in related banking operations and financial services, and a ~$4 billion agency budget and financial services unit. In this leadership role, Rodrigo leverages financial innovation, investment stewardship, corporate governance, stakeholder capitalism and equity, diversity, and inclusion to maximize investment returns and bolster the Illinois macro and micro economies. He is an Adjunct Professor at Northwestern University, an Aspen Global Finance Fellow and a recent TEDx speaker. He also is a Certified Treasury Professional (CTP®), an Accredited Investment Fiduciary (AIF®), and holds SASB’s FSA credential.
Corporate Boards: Framework IT
Sheila G. Talton
President and CEO — Gray Matter Analytics, Inc.
Sheila G. Talton is currently the President and CEO of Gray Matter Analytics, the leader in healthcare Analytics as a Service. She founded the company in 2013. Her experience in governance extends to corporate, civic and not-for-profit sectors; currently serving on the boards of Deere & Company, Sysco Corporation, OGE Energy Corp., Chicago’s Northwestern Memorial Hospital Foundation, The Chicago Network, the Chicago Shakespeare Theater and The Chicago Urban League. Sheila’s latest mission at Gray Matter is to encourage clients to take ownership of their data, maximize its value and more effectively standardize data across large, complex enterprises to address interoperability challenges that proliferate in healthcare. She is an innovative global leader and Big Data strategist with over 30 years of experience in helping organizations increase value, build successful businesses within larger companies and expand into emerging markets. She is recognized for her expertise in developing and executing bold initiatives.
Corporate Boards: John Deere, Sysco, OGE Energy Corp
